Lawrenson Predicts The Result As Arsenal Take On Burnley

BBC pundit Mark Lawrenson isn’t expecting Arsenal to get the three points when they face Burnley at Turf Moor in the lunchtime kickoff tomorrow.

Despite the Gunners heading into the match in confident mood after an excellent display versus Leicester last weekend, the Clarets also drew with the Foxes during the week, and Lawrenson thinks Sean Dyche’s men will put in a similar performance on Saturday:


“Burnley were much improved when they shared the points with Leicester on Wednesday, while Arsenal were very impressive when they beat the Foxes at the weekend. The Gunners will want revenge for their home defeat by the Clarets before Christmas, when they had Granit Xhaka sent off and Pierre-Emerick Aubameyang scored Burnley’s winner with an own goal. It is a draw I am going for here, though, which will help keep Burnley edging away from the bottom three.

Lawrenson has gone with a 1-1 draw, which isn’t an entirely surprising prediction. As he mentions, Burnley won the reverse fixture earlier this season so it will not be an easy game.

However, the fact that the Clarets have had to play an extra game midweek should play into Arsenal’s hands. Mikel Arteta’s side have pretty much had a full week to prepare for this match, and while a trip to Turf Moor is always fraught with danger, there is every chance that they could secure victory if they play anything like they did against Leicester.
